api icon indicating copy to clipboard operation
api copied to clipboard

Physical Dimensions service and 3D

Open tomcrane opened this issue 1 year ago • 4 comments

Extend https://iiif.io/api/annex/services/#physical-dimensions and describe how it applies to Scene

Complexity cf 2D - the content resources (models) may have their own physical dimensions data as they are brought into the Scene

(This is not part of the Presentation API, it's an external service - at the moment, at least)

tomcrane avatar Jan 30 '24 17:01 tomcrane

(very) unlike 2D, would we say that IIIF Scenes have a default phys dim of 1m per unit?

tomcrane avatar Jan 30 '24 17:01 tomcrane

In the 99% case of a single model targeting the whole Scene, where that Scene has no phys dim service declared but the model being painted might have scale information, does the Scene inherit the scale of the model?

Or is that going to introduce unresolvable problems - if I later painted a second model in, what happens?

Maybe this is meaningless as a viewer that wanted to show a ruler for a single model Scene could just use the model's scale.

tomcrane avatar Jan 30 '24 17:01 tomcrane

Consensus from DC meeting - a Scene does not have a default physical dimensions service of 1m-1 unit. But ability to assert a phys dim service is very important.

tomcrane avatar Jan 30 '24 19:01 tomcrane

Eds to discuss and determine complexity -- is this a quick reference or are there issues to discuss

azaroth42 avatar Jan 31 '24 22:01 azaroth42